Title
Analysis of plane wave scattering by a conducting elliptic cylinder near a ground plane

Abstract
Electromagnetic compatibility is a major problem in mobile communications. In this paper, we analyse the phenomena of electromagnetic wave scattering by obstacles present in the communication path. Here the scattering model consists of an infinite cylindrical conductor near an infinite conducting plane. This scattering problem involving the conducting plane can be exchanged with that of two elliptic cylinders, using the theory of images. Expansion of fields in terms of Mathieu functions is used to analytically describe the scattered field. To apply the boundary conditions, we have used, in the analysis, the addition theorem of Mathieu functions. We obtained an exact solution for the present problem, and the near fields are numerically computed for different parameters
